Ingredients

Before we start with the recipe, let's take a look at the ingredients that you will need:

  • 1 can of Campbell's Cream of Mushroom Soup
  • 1 can of Campbell's Cream of Potato Soup
  • 1 can of Campbell's Cream of Celery Soup
  • 1 can of whole milk
  • 1 cup of lump crab meat
  • 1/4 cup of butter
  • 1/4 cup of all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 teaspoon of Old Bay seasoning
  • 1/4 teaspoon of black pepper
  • Salt to taste
  • 1/4 cup of chopped fresh parsley (optional)

Instructions

Now that you have all of your ingredients ready, it is time to start cooking. Here are the step-by-step instructions for making Campbell's Cream of Crab Soup:

  1. In a large pot, melt the butter over medium heat. Once the butter has melted, add the flour and whisk until smooth.
  2. Add the three cans of Campbell's soup and whisk together with the butter and flour mixture until it is well combined.
  3. Gradually stir in the whole milk while continuing to whisk the mixture. Be sure to stir constantly to prevent any clumps from forming.
  4. Once the milk has been added, add the Old Bay seasoning, black pepper, and salt to taste. Stir to combine.
  5. Bring the mixture to a simmer over medium heat.
  6. Add the lump crab meat and stir to combine. Let the soup cook for about 5-10 minutes, or until the crab meat is heated through.
  7. If you like, you can add the chopped fresh parsley for a little extra flavor and color.
  8. Remove the soup from the heat and let it cool for a few minutes before serving.

Additional Tips

If you want to add a little bit of extra flavor to your Campbell's Cream of Crab Soup, here are a few additional tips:

  • Try adding a teaspoon of Worcestershire sauce or a dash of hot sauce to give the soup a bit of a kick
  • If you prefer a more chunky soup, you can add some diced celery, onion, or potatoes to the mixture before cooking
  • If you like a creamier soup, you can add some heavy cream or half-and-half instead of whole milk
  • Don't forget to season the soup with salt and pepper to taste
